About the Role:
The KA Group is a global leader in the design, manufacture, and distribution of earthmoving scrapers. A CNC (Computer Numerical Control) brake operator is responsible for setting up, operating, and maintaining CNC brake machine. The role requires a combination of technical skills, mechanical knowledge, and the ability to interpret blueprints and schematics.
Key Duties and Responsibilities
- Set up and calibrate CNC brake machines based on specifications.
- Load materials onto the machine bed and ensure correct alignment.
- Program or input CNC codes for specific bending tasks.
- Operate the CNC brake machine to bend metal sheets to specified angles and dimensions.
- Monitor the machine's performance and adjust as necessary to maintain quality.
- Ensure that all safety protocols are followed while operating the machine.
- Measure and inspect finished parts to ensure they meet quality standards and specifications.
- Adjust machine settings or processes to correct any defects or errors in the bending process.
- Record production data, including quantities, machine settings, and any issues that occur during operation.
- Ensure that proper documentation is kept for traceability and quality control.
- Always wear app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) while operating the machine.
